D'Iberville has the newest housing on this coast by a wide margin. Its median year built is 2003, with 3,157 of 5,390 units, 58.6 percent, built in 2000 or later and 1,385 units, 25.7 percent, built since 2010, against only 19.8 percent from before 1980.
That stock fails in the opposite way to its older neighbours. It is not old enough to rot from age, so the calls are about details that were never right: a flashing junction, an unsealed fastener, a caulk joint that opened. The symptom is a ceiling stain, not a soft fascia board.
The rule that shapes work here is the city's Flood Damage Prevention Ordinance. It caps substantial improvements to a structure inside a designated Flood Hazard Area at 50 percent of fair market value, and the city states that the number is cumulative for the life of the structure.
Because it is cumulative and not per project, a third or fourth improvement can cross the line even when this particular job is small, and crossing it forces full compliance including elevation. That is a question to ask before the quote is written, not after demolition.
Two more D'Iberville rules change how a job is built. Below the Design Flood Elevation the city requires flood resistant materials for interior walls, ceilings and floors, and prohibits mechanical, electrical and plumbing devices from being installed down there at all. Standard paper faced drywall is not a permitted finish.
Enclosed areas below that elevation need at least two flood openings on opposing walls, totalling at least 1 square inch for every square foot of footprint, with the bottom of each opening no more than 1 foot above the finished floor. Closing in a carport here is a vent arithmetic problem before it is a framing problem.
